How Real-Money Online Slot Machines Actually Work
Every spin on a licensed UK slot machine is an independent event determined by a certified Random Number Generator (RNG). The RNG cycles through thousands of numbers per second, and the moment you press spin, it locks one in. That number maps to a position on the game’s virtual reel strip. This process is audited by independent testing labs — typically eCOGRA, iTech Labs, or GLI — to ensure the house edge stays consistent with the stated theoretical Return to Player (RTP).
RTP is the percentage of all wagered money a slot is programmed to pay back over millions of spins. A machine with a 96.5% RTP will, theoretically, return £96.50 for every £100 staked in the long run. In the short term, variance — or volatility — creates the ups and downs. Low-volatility slots deliver frequent small wins; high-volatility slots dish out larger wins but with longer dry spells. For a balanced real-money session, many experienced players pair a medium-volatility game with a sensible session budget.

Decoding RTP, Volatility, and Certified RNG Testing
Not all slots are created equal, even from the same provider. Many game variants are marketed with different RTP settings, and a UKGC-licensed operator must display the version they use. Always check the game’s info screen or paytable before spinning with real money. A 2% difference — say 96% versus 94% — might not sound huge, but over a 1,000-spin session at £1 per spin, it represents a £20 gap in theoretical return.
Volatility is not published as a single number. Instead, developers classify it as low, medium, high, or very high. Some advanced game sheets show a volatility index figure, but most players rely on the provider’s label. For example, a high-volatility game from Big Time Gaming might show wins of 5,000x your stake, but you could spin 200 times without a feature. That is why matching volatility to your bankroll and playing style is critical.
Certified RNG testing is mandatory for every UKGC-licensed operator. The testing house issues a certificate that the operator must display or link to from the game page. If you cannot find a certification mark, that is a red flag. Stick with operators who are transparent about their audit status.
Defining Feature Mechanics: Megaways, Jackpots, and Hold-and-Win
The category “best online slot machines UK” has evolved far beyond three reels and a single payline. Several core mechanics define modern play: Megaways, which deliver a random number of symbols per reel on each spin, creating up to 117,649 ways to win; jackpot slots, which link to a pooled prize that grows as players bet across a network; and Hold-and-Win or Cash Collect rounds, where special symbols lock in place and award respins. Each mechanic brings a distinct feel to the reels.
- Megaways — Each spin delivers a random number of symbols per reel, creating up to 117,649 ways to win. The engine changes the reel height on every spin, so the payline count fluctuates wildly. It adds unpredictability and huge win potential, but volatility is almost always high.
- Jackpot slots — These link to a pooled prize that grows as players bet across a network. The most common are fixed jackpots (a set prize) or progressive jackpots that climb until one lucky spin triggers the top tier. The odds of hitting a major progressive are slim — often millions to one — but the potential is life-changing.
- Hold-and-Win / Cash Collect — During the bonus round, special symbols lock in place and award respins. Each new symbol resets the respin counter and adds to your total. The round ends when you run out of respins. This mechanic is popular in games like “88 Fortunes” and “Buffalo Gold.”

Stake Limits and Responsible Session Structure in the UK
Since 2025, the UK Gambling Commission has enforced stake limits for online slots. The maximum allowed bet per spin is £5 for players aged 25 and over. For players aged 18 to 24, the limit is £2 per spin. These rules apply to all UKGC-licensed operators and cover every slot game, including Megaways and progressive jackpot titles. There is no exception for high-rollers or VIP tiers.
These limits are designed to reduce harm, but they also affect session planning. A player spinning at £5 per spin could, theoretically, lose £300 in an hour if they spin once every six seconds. A good session structure means setting a loss limit before you start, using the operator’s deposit cap tools, and taking a five-minute break every twenty spins. Most licensed sites now offer a “reality check” pop-up that reminds you how long you have been playing. Use it.
Using a credit card to gamble has been prohibited in Great Britain since April 2020, so you must fund your account with a debit card, e-wallet, or pre-paid card. Deposits are instant, but withdrawal times vary by method.

Quickfire Answers: Five Reader Questions on Real-Money Slots
Do I need to play demo mode before using real money?
It is a smart habit, not a requirement. Demo mode lets you test a slot’s volatility, feature frequency, and bonus round without spending a penny. Many UK operators offer free spins or demo credits on their most popular titles, so you can find a game that suits your style before you commit cash.
Should I chase a progressive jackpot?
Only with money you can afford to lose. Progressive jackpots like Mega Moolah have a low base-game RTP (around 88%) because a portion of every bet feeds the jackpot pool. The odds of hitting the top prize are extremely long. Treat a jackpot spin as entertainment, not an investment.
How do I choose between a high and low volatility slot?
Consider your session length and bankroll. Low volatility is ideal for longer sessions with a small budget — you get frequent small wins that stretch your play. High volatility suits players with a larger bankroll who can withstand dry spells for a chance at a 5,000x or bigger win. If you want both, pick a medium-volatility game.
What does RTP actually mean for my session?
RTP is a long-term average calculated over millions of spins. It does not predict the outcome of a single session. A slot with 96% RTP could produce a loss or a win on any given day. However, over many sessions, the house edge will assert itself. Always view RTP as a guide, not a guarantee.
When should I use the operator’s deposit limit tool?
Before you deposit. Setting a daily, weekly, or monthly deposit limit is the most effective way to control your spend. UKGC-licensed operators must offer these tools, and they are reversible only after a cooling-off period. Set your limit at the start of each month, not after a losing session.
